Cuisine: Norwegian, ScandinavianEstimated Reading Time: 5 minsCategory: Bread1. To make the bread, in a small saucepan, melt the butter. Add the milk and scald. Remove from the heat and add the cardamom, letting the spice steep while the milk lowers in temperature to 110 degrees F.
2. In a mixing bowl, combine the yeast with 1/2 teaspoon of the sugar and pour a little of the lukewarm milk over them. Let proof until it bubbles, 5 to 10 minutes.
3. Stir in the remaining milk, along with the eggs, remaining sugar, the orange zest, salt, and cinnamon. Add 5 cups of flour and gently mix, adding additional small amounts until the dough begins to pull away from the sides of the bowl. (You may not need to use the full 6 cups of flour.)
4. Transfer to a lightly floured surface and knead for about 10 minutes. Fold in the dried fruit and transfer to a lightly greased bowl. Cover with a clean tea towel and let rise until doubled, about 1 hour.

Calories: 317 per servingCategory: Bread1. Pour the flour into a mixing bowl and add the salt and yeast on opposite sides. Stir each one in with your finger.
2. Mix in the sugar, cardamom, butter, and eggs until well combined.
3. Warm the milk to 115 F in the microwave or a small saucepan, then gradually add it to the flour mixture. Stir and crush the ingredients together with your hand and continue adding milk until a somewhat sticky dough forms.
4. Turn the dough onto a floured surface and knead until the dough is no longer sticky and passes the windowpane test, about 10-15 minutes. Do the windowpane test by pulling off a lump of dough and stretching it as thin as you can. If it stretches to be translucent without tearing, it's kneaded enough.
